From our headquarters in the heart of London, The Standard podcast sets the agenda. Top news insiders discuss the pressure-points of the day’s topics. Hear unrivalled insight on politics, culture, going out, sport, and fashion, with award-winning journalists and celebrity guests. Join us Monday to Friday at 4pm.

Renters Rights Act: Will it drive landlords from the market?
Q: Can you remind us what changes will be implemented?
The key changes include the end of no fault evictions, abolishment of fixed term tenancies, and clearer rules on rent increases.

Frequently Asked Questions About The Standard

What is The Standard about and what kind of topics does it cover?

This podcast features in-depth discussions on current affairs, politics, and cultural events, addressing the most pressing issues impacting society today. Episodes showcase insights from industry experts, celebrity guests, and journalists who provide unique perspectives on topics ranging from migration and international relations to local events and cultural phenomena. Notable discussions have included food price inflation, political upheaval, and significant societal challenges that resonate with a diverse audience. The format's distinct blend of expert analysis and everyday relevance makes it an engaging listen for anyone interested in understanding the complexities of the modern world.
